 1.27  07-Oct-2017  jdolecek Merge support for SATA NCQ (Native Command Queueing) from jdolecek-ncq branch

ATA subsystem was changed to support several outstanding commands, and use
NCQ xfers if supported by both the controller and the disk, including NCQ
error recovery. Set NCQ high priority for BPRIO_TIMECRITICAL xfers
if supported. Added FUA support.

Done some work towards MP-safe, all ATA code tsleep()/wakeup() replaced
by condvars, and switched most code from spl* to mutexes (separate
wd(4) and ata channel lock).

Introduced new option WD_CHAOS_MONKEY to facilitate testing of error
handling, fixed several uncovered issues. Also fixed several problems
with kernel dump to wd(4) disk.

Tested with ahcisata(4), mvsata(4), siisata(4), piixide(4) on amd64,
with and without port multiplier, both disk and ATAPI devices; other
drivers and archs mechanically adjusted and compile-tested. NCQ is
supported for ahcisata(4) and siisata(4) for any controller, for
mvsata(4) only Gen IIe ones for now. Also enabled ATAPI support in
mvsata(4).

Thanks to Matt Thomas for initial ATA infrastructure patch, and
Jonathan A.Kollasch for siisata(4) NCQ changes and general testing.

Also fixes PR kern/43169 (wd(4)); and PR kern/11811, PR kern/47041,
PR kern/51979 (kernel dump)

 1.22  02-Jul-2012  bouyer Add sata Port MultiPlier (PMP) support to the ata bus layer,
as described in
http://mail-index.netbsd.org/tech-kern/2012/06/23/msg013442.html
PMP support in integrated to the atabus layer.
struct ata_channel's ch_drive[] is not dynamically allocated, and ch_ndrive
(renamed to ch_ndrives) closely reflects the size of the ch_drive[] array.
Add helper functions atabus_alloc_drives() and atabus_free_drives()
to manage ch_drive[]/ch_ndrives.
Add wdc_maxdrives to struct wdc_softc so that bus front-end can specify
how much drive they really support (master/slave or single).
ata_reset_drive() callback gains a uint32_t *sigp argument which,
when not NULL, will contain the signature of the device being reset.
While there, some cosmetic changes:
- added a drive_type enum to ata_drive_datas, and stop encoding the
probed drive type in drive_flags (we were out of drive flags anyway).
- rename DRIVE_ATAPIST to DRIVE_ATAPIDSCW to better reflect what this
really is
- remove ata_channel->ata_drives, it's redundant with the pointer in
ata_drive_datas
- factor out the interpretation of SATA signatures in sata_interpet_sig()

propagate these changes to the ATA HBA drivers, and add support for PMP
to ahcisata(4) and siisata(4).

 1.3  14-Aug-2004  thorpej - Split the register handles out of struct wdc_channel into a separate
wdc_regs structure, and array of which (indexed per channel) is pointed
to by struct wdc_softc.
- Move the resulting wdc_channel structure to atavar.h and rename it to
ata_channel. Rename the corresponding flags.
- Add a "ch_ndrive" member to struct ata_channel, which indicates the
maximum number of drives that can be present on the channel. For now,
this is always 2. Add an ATA_MAXDRIVES constant that places an upper
limit on this value, also currently 2.
